In Archetopical, history professor-turned-podcaster CJ Killmer invites you along on his journey to better understand reality, the human experience, and how to find meaning and a sense of efficacy in our increasingly insane world.

Episode 1: The Hero's Journey

E

Join CJ as he shares an overview of the structure & archetypes of the Hero's Journey monomyth and associated archetypes (as popularized by people like Joseph Campbell & Christopher Vogler), and explains why he thinks these are important things to understand that can actually help us to navigate through our real-life challenges & struggles.
